We are looking for an experienced, multitasking, Office Manager to join our Admin team. This is a full-time, maternity leave replacement for a period of minimum 1 year, work-from-office position. This position will support the local and global teams. The Admin team is responsible for ensuring the smooth running of the office and helping to improve company procedures and day-to-day operations.

Responsibilities

  • Organize office layout, food and refreshments, and other office functions
  • Support construction, renovation and relocation projects
  • Manage office health, safety, and security procedures
  • Liaise with facility management vendors, including cleaning, catering and maintenance
  • Order and manage office equipment, stationery, and supplies and track the inventory
  • Track expenses, manage budget and review invoices
  • Address administrative requests
  • Arrange transportation, accommodation, expenses and other assistance to our traveling staff and incoming visitors
  • Assist in onboarding and offboarding of employees
  • Provide general support to visitors
  • Assist the Director of Global Operations as required
